Wine Shine is a small batch mom & pop brandy distillery located in Tin City. They've got several unique flavors and they're all easy to drink and high potency! Since I can't go to Paso Robles due to the never ending pandemic I decided to order some bottles for myself and some for my dad as a Christmas present. They had free shipping if you order 3 bottles or more. My favorite cocktail is a Manhattan so I ordered their "Manhattan Project Brandy" which is their tribute to the awesome cocktail. It's a fantastic tribute and both my dad, my wife, and I love it. They mix their brandy with vermouth and bitters and it really comes close to the cocktail except this is ready to drink by just pouring it over some ice. Next favorite was the cinnamon brandy aged in French oak barrel. If you enjoy Fireball Whisky you'll love this. It's 80 proof yet smooth drinking. Their orange brandy also amazing. Again, for 80 proof this stuff is easy to drink and tastes great. The last flavor and least favorite I bought was the Hibiscus Lemon Brandy. First few attempts at drinking it I thought it was nasty. Wife hated it. By the 3rd time I started liking it. Now I really enjoy it :-D Goes great added to hot tea. These brandies are good enough on their own I just pour some over ice. I haven't made any cocktails yet unless you count adding the hibiscus one to tea. That's the bottles I got. Other choices they have is neutral brandy, mano ginger black pepper, ghost pepper, oak aged, fig, and they make vodka.
